It's called Hayburn Wyke and it's just north of Scarborough, on the way to Ravenscar. This peaceful spot has a rocky beach and a waterfall, making it ideal for a tranquil walk.

The Hayburn Wyke waterfalls are made up of two falls cascading down from the woods above to the pebbly beach below. The clear, cool water and surrounding rocks and caves create a peaceful, serene atmosphere perfect for relaxation and exploration. Visitors can dip in the refreshing water, explore the caves, and rock pools, or sit back and soak.

How to Find Hayburn Wyke Waterfall. Hayburn Wyke Waterfall is a short drive north of Scarborough. If you turn off the Whitby road and follow signs for Ravenscar there is a right-hand turn for Hayburn Wyke off this road. Hayburn Wyke is a natural cove and part of a National Trust nature reserve. Hayburn Wyke Beach Location. Hayburn Wyke is located just 7 miles North of Scarborough, but is a world away from the busy North Bay and South Bay beaches. If you are using a navigation system, the exact location is: Hayburn wyke, Scarborough YO12 6LD (you cannot drive right to the beach so see below for directions).

This 5-mile circular walk follows an exhilarating stretch of the Cleveland Way National Trail footpath above the cliffs to Hayburn Wyke, before returning along the track-bed of the old Scarborough to Whitby railway line. Cloughton and Hayburn Wyke. Get to know this 4.4-mile loop trail near Scarborough, North Yorkshire. Generally considered a moderately challenging route, it takes an average of 2 h 7 min to complete. This is a very popular area for birding, hiking, and running, so you'll likely encounter other people while exploring.

Start/Finish: Hood Lane. Post Code for the area is YO13 0AT. Where is it: Hayburn Wyke is located on the coast of the North York Moors, just north of Scarborough. Public Transport: The nearest train station is Cloughton. You can easily start the walk to Hayburn Wyke from there. It will add about 1 mile to the route.
